    Earlier this week, former unified heavyweight champion Andy "The Destroyer" Ruiz Jr. took fans inside his training camp Thursday during a virtual media workout that streamed live on the PBC YouTube page, as Ruiz prepares to take on Chris "The Nightmare" Arreola Saturday, May 1 in the FOX Sports PBC Pay-Per-View main event from Dignity Health Sports Park in Carson, Calif.
